Temple of Isis Site Help - Uploading and Managing Images

The bottom link in the control panel and on the right side of the Edit Toolbar in the Edit Temple Web Page and Edit Blog forms brings you to a simple interface to upload images for use in your temple blog or Temple Web page. You are allowed up to 10 images in any valid image format (.jpg, .gif, .png) and can view, delete, or upload new images as required.

To upload images to your account, you simply type in a name for the image in the title field and browse your computer for the image file. Any web-compatible image file is supported - jpeg, gif, or png - but non-web file formats such as tiff, eps, video, or other files will be rejected.

If it's taking too long to upload an image: Although this web site automatically sizes images for the web, it is a good idea to scale down your images to approximately 600 pixels wide and a maximum of 100 KB in file size if you know how. Otherwise it may take an unusual amount of time to upload your images.

Setting the image width or height is optional. If you do not size your images, they will default to the maximum of 500 px width or 500 px height. This is to avoid "blowing up" your web page by having the images exceed the template width.

Additionally, this option allows you to format several smaller images across the page and affords a greater control over your web page and blog layout. Feel free to experiment with various image sizes for your images.
